25-year-old woman shot at MARTA station, may have been ‘unintended target’ police say

ATLANTA — A woman was shot early Sunday at the Midtown MARTA station and may have been an “unintended target,” police said, after gunfire broke out in a verbal dispute.

The Atlanta Police Department said the woman was taken to a hospital by ambulance and was alert, conscious and breathing at the time; there were no additional details available about her injuries or condition.

According to APD, it happened just before 1 a.m. A police statement said a possible suspected was detained near the scene by MARTA Police…
